Its in-state tuition and fees are $17,138; out-of-state tuition and fees are $35,110. The department of education defines graduation rate as the percentage of full-time, first-time students who received a degree or award within 150% of "normal time" to completion. In 2021, 7,960 degrees were awarded to men at University of Illinois at Urbana-Champaign, which is 1.11 times more than the number of degrees awarded to females (7,157). In 2019 the default rate for borrower's at University of Illinois at Urbana-Champaign was 0.649%, which represents 37 out of the 5702 total borrowers. Graduation rate is defined as the percentage of full-time, first-time students who received a degree or award within a specific percentage of "normal time" to completion for their program. The most common race/ethnicity group of degree recipients was white (6,182 degrees), 2.65 times more than then the next closest race/ethnicity group, asian (2,333 degrees). As of 2021, University of Illinois at Urbana-Champaign received $974M in grants and contracts from the federal government, $106M from state grants and contracts, and $23.5M from local grants and contracts.
